I am aware there are many people in Brentwood who need to get to hospital appointments and consultations but have difficulty in finding appropriate and affordable travel options. This is why it's good to hear the NHS Clinical Commissioning Groups (CCGs) in Mid and South Essex have carried out a procurement exercise for the contract to operate the non-emergency patient transport service across the whole of mid and South Essex which covers Basildon and Brentwood, Castle Point and Rochford, Mid Essex, Southend and Thurrock CCG areas.
HTG-UK, formerly Thames Ambulance Service, has operated non-emergency patient transport services in the region since 2009 and was already one of the incumbent providers in mid and south Essex. Non-emergency patient transport is a critical cog in the NHS system, ensuring patients are able to access healthcare appointments and supporting flow through our local hospitals.
